Black, James Byers was born on May 6, 1890 in Sycamore, Illinois, United States. Son of Charles Albert and Olive (Byers) Black.
Bachelor of Science, University California, 1912, Doctor of Laws, 1958. Doctor of Laws, University San Francisco, 1958.
Service inspector Great Western Power Company, 1912-1918, general sales manager, 1918-1922, general manager, since 1922, vice president, since 1923. Vice president Western Power Corporation, 1926, North American Company, 1927-1935. President, director, member Executive Committee Pacific Gas & Electric Company, San Francisco, 1935-1955, Chairman of the Board, director, member Executive Committee, since 1955.
Chairman, director Pacific Gas Transmission Company, Alberta Natural Gas Company, Alberta & Southern Gas Company. Director, member Executive Committee Shell Oil Corporation, Southern Pacific Company, Fireman’s Fund Insurance Company, member of advisory commission to board Chemical Bank New York Trust Company. Director Equitable Life Assurance Society, Del Monte Properties Company, Federal Maritime Commission Corporation Director emeritus Stanford Research Institute.
Director New York World’s Fair 1964-1965 Corporation.
Member Business Council. Member of Pacific Coast Committee (vice chairman), Newcomen Society, Big C Society, Eta Kappa Nu, Chi Phi, Tau Beta Pi, Golden Bear, Skull and Keys. Clubs: Links, Brook, Twenty-Nine (New York City).
Married Katharine McElrath, March 24, 1913. Children: James Byers, Charles Alden, Kathryn (Mistress Joseph W. Burk).
